Inaugural Two Bays ITT Round 1 – Event Report

The ride saw 14 heady MUcyc riders leave Port Melbourne for 120+km of idyllic riding. The stretch between Port Melbourne and Mordialloc was strewn with traffic, bike and car alike and so the pace was inconsistent. Once the peloton made it past Mordialloc the pace settled and the riders got into a comfortable rhythm. The arrival in Mt Eliza marked the 1st official MUcyc Two Bays ITT. All riders pushed hard as respectable times were recorded across the board. Billy Rebakis stormed home on the false flat section at the top to record the overall best time winning himself a delicious PRO4 Energy Bar for the ride home (see pic below) courtesy of MUcyc and Borsari Cycles. A great ride from all and we hope to see everyone and more at the next instalment coming soon.
